What is Miso Broth?

Miso broth is a soul-warming elixir made by blending miso paste with water or stock, creating a rich and savory liquid base. This Japanese staple offers a harmonious balance of salty, earthy, and slightly sweet flavors, derived from fermented soybeans and grains like rice or barley. Infused with depth by ingredients like kombu seaweed and dried bonito flakes, miso broth serves as the perfect canvas for crafting comforting soups and noodle dishes, promising a satisfying culinary experience with every spoonful.

miso paste

miso paste

Miso paste is made from fermented soybeans and has a pasty pliable quality. Miso is also made with various grains and other legumes. There are four common types of miso: white, yellow red and black. White miso tastes sweet. Yellow miso tastes mild and earthy. Red miso has a deep umami flavor. Black miso tastes like marmite. Each miso is salty. It is used as flavoring for soups and many sauces and stir fries.

green chard

green chard

Chard is a green leafy vegetable that contains oxalic acid, which is what creates the film on the inside of the mouth when chard and spinach are consumed. These leaves are wide and green with white stalks through the center. Chard cooks quickly and is tender with a mild vegetal flavor that some people describe as bitter.

wakame seaweed

wakame seaweed

Wakame is a type of seaweed used in East Asian cuisine. It is a sea vegetable with a dark, vibrant green color and a hint of translucence. Wakame grows in huge leaf-like sheets in the ocean and when harvested they are hung up to dry and cut into small strips. Dry wakame is tiny, hard and crunchy. Once rehydrated the sea plant is ready to eat. The texture is slippery and the flavor is salty with a sea vegetal taste. Wakame is used in salads, soups and various Japanese and East Asian dishes.
